Transaction 10fcb515deb5d650da282b0b7420360c660816aed3b5824e3b5fb43b3ae76065
1 Input
1 Output
-
10fcb515deb5d650da282b0b7420360c660816aed3b5824e3b5fb43b3ae76065:0
- value
- 8082792831
- script pubkey
- OP_0 OP_PUSHBYTES_32 f27919706d6c36f9ad00df1cefef5245da13aefb569d78b75c8ea6497c13ac49
- address
- bc1q7fu3jurddsm0ntgqmuwwlm6jghdp8thm26wh3d6u36nyjlqn43yssr4aek